Tips for Buying A Business

Conduct Thorough Due Diligence

Before making any commitments, it’s essential to perform comprehensive due diligence. This means carefully reviewing the business’s financial statements, tax returns, legal agreements, and operational processes. Look for any red flags such as declining revenues, outstanding liabilities, or pending litigation. Engage professional advisors, such as accountants and lawyers, to help you understand both the risks and the opportunities associated with the business. A meticulous approach in this phase ensures there are no unpleasant surprises after the purchase.

Assess Strategic Fit and Growth Potential

Evaluate how well the business aligns with your skills, experience, and long-term goals. Consider whether the industry is stable or growing, and assess the company’s competitive position within that market. Look for untapped opportunities, such as expanding into new markets, improving marketing strategies, or introducing new products or services. Acquiring a business with room for growth not only increases the likelihood of long-term success but also enhances the value of your investment.

Negotiate a Win-Win Deal

When it comes time to make an offer, structure the deal in a way that balances your interests with those of the seller. This might include negotiating a fair purchase price, favorable payment terms, or even transition support from the seller. Don’t be afraid to walk away if the terms aren’t right—staying disciplined will prevent costly mistakes. Effective negotiation and clear communication help build trust and set the foundation for a smooth transition and ongoing business success.
